#707cf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#707cf0 is composed of 43.9% red, 48.6%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 69%. #707cf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0f8ff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#707cf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#707cf0 has RGB values of R:112, G:124,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7372016.

Shades and Tints of #707cf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020311 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#707cf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adadb3 is the less saturated color, while #6472fc is the most saturated one.
